A communication serves as a formal notification to a candidate selected for the next stage of a hiring process. This correspondence typically outlines the specifics of the meeting, including date, time, location (physical or virtual), and individuals involved. For example, such a message might state: “Subject: Interview Invitation Marketing Manager Position. Dear [Candidate Name], We are pleased to invite you to interview for the Marketing Manager position on [Date] at [Time] via [Platform]. Please confirm your availability by [Response Date].”
This type of message is a crucial component of effective recruitment, providing candidates with necessary information to prepare and attend the meeting. Sending it promptly and professionally reflects positively on the organization, contributing to a positive candidate experience. Historically, such notifications were delivered primarily via postal mail or telephone, but email has become the standard due to its speed and efficiency.
